Williams dressed for No. 14 Tennessee's home game against South Carolina on Saturday night.

The Bronx, N.Y., native was one of four Vols players disciplined for drug, gun and alcohol charges stemming from the traffic stop and has not participated in any team activity since the beginning of the year.

Tyler Smith was dismissed from the team for his role, while guards Cameron Tatum and Melvin Goins were reinstated Jan. 17.

Coach Bruce Pearl says he feels he treated each player fairly with their discipline and hopes they have grown from the experience.
